Comprehending UPVC Door Frames


UPVC represents a considerable improvement in building products technology. Unlike basic PVC, which contains plasticizers that make it flexible, UPVC undergoes a specialized manufacturing procedure that gets rid of these ingredients. The result is a rigid, durable material that keeps its shape and structural stability under different environmental conditions. UPVC door frames have become progressively popular in modern-day construction and remodelling tasks due to their exceptional combination of performance attributes and cost-effectiveness.

The product displays remarkable resistance to weathering, wetness, and chemical exposure. Unlike wood, which can warp, rot, or need routine painting, UPVC keeps its look and performance with very little upkeep. This strength makes it especially ideal for exterior door applications where frames must stand up to the aspects year after year.

Secret Advantages of UPVC Door Frames


The decision to set up UPVC door frames brings various advantages that contribute to their growing popularity among house owners and home builders alike. Energy performance stands as one of the most substantial advantages, as UPVC frames supply outstanding thermal insulation when properly set up. The material's intrinsic homes help in reducing heat transfer between the interior and outside of a home, possibly reducing heating & cooling expenses throughout the year.

Toughness represents another compelling reason to select UPVC. These frames withstand corrosion, do not rust, and keep their structural homes across a wide temperature level range. They prove especially effective in seaside locations where salt air can speed up the deterioration of metal fixtures and fittings. UPVC frames generally include warranties varying from 10 to 25 years, showing producers' confidence in their longevity.

From an aesthetic point of view, UPVC door frames use adaptability that appeals to varied style preferences. They are offered in numerous colors, surfaces, and styles, including choices that replicate the appearance of conventional wood without the associated maintenance requirements. The smooth, non-porous surface resists dirt accumulation and can be cleaned up easily with standard home items.

Pre-Installation Preparation


Comprehensive preparation before setup substantially impacts the last result. House owners should initially get rid of the existing door frame carefully, making sure not to harm the surrounding wall structure. This procedure involves eliminating the door itself, then detaching the frame from the wall using proper tools. Any damaged or degraded wall sections should be repaired before proceeding with the brand-new installation.

Accurate measurements form the cornerstone of successful door frame installation. Professionals recommend determining the door opening at 3 points: the leading, middle, and bottom. The final measurements ought to reflect the tiniest of these measurements to ensure an appropriate fit. Additionally, determining the diagonal measurements assists validate that the opening is square, as significant disparities might require restorative action before setup.

Examining the structural stability of the surrounding wall proves equally essential. The wall must can securely anchoring the brand-new door frame. In many cases, especially with older homes, extra assistances or structural modifications may be essential to make sure a strong structure for the setup.

Step-by-Step Installation Process


The installation of a UPVC door frame follows an organized procedure that, when performed correctly, leads to a secure, weatherproof, and appropriately functioning door. Understanding this procedure helps house owners either carry out the job themselves or successfully supervise professional installation.

Frame Assembly and Positioning

Ensure all joints are tight and secure before continuing, as any weak point in the frame structure will jeopardize the last installation.

Position the assembled frame within the door opening, using wooden shims to accomplish the right height and level. The frame must rest on an ideal surface area— ideally a concrete sill or treated timber limit— that offers appropriate support and security versus moisture rising from listed below. Using a spirit level, confirm that both the frame sides and top are perfectly horizontal and vertical.

Protecting and Insulation

After achieving appropriate positioning, protect the frame to the wall structure through the pre-drilled repairing points. Generally, these points are situated at intervals of 600mm along the frame sides. Use suitable wall anchors to guarantee protected fixation, particularly in masonry where the mendings need to penetrate sufficiently into the substrate. Prevent over-tightening, which can distort the frame profile.

Once secured, deal with the gaps in between the frame and the surrounding wall. Expanding foam, applied thoroughly and allowed to treat completely, provides effective thermal and acoustic insulation while keeping versatility to accommodate small structural motions. After the foam has actually treated, any excess must be cut flush with the wall surface area.

Last Adjustments and Hardware Installation

The door leaf can now be hung on the hinges, with careful attention to correct positioning and operation. Check the door's swing pattern and guarantee it closes squarely within the frame without binding or extreme clearance. Adjust the hinges as needed to achieve ideal operation, ensuring the door sits flush with the frame when closed.

Install the handle mechanism and any extra hardware according to the producer's specifications. Locking mechanisms need particular attention to ensure they engage effectively with the frame keeps. A poorly lined up lock not just compromises security however can also cause premature wear on moving parts.

Typical Installation Mistakes to Avoid


Even knowledgeable installers can come across obstacles during UPVC door frame installation. Awareness of common mistakes helps guarantee successful outcomes and avoids pricey callbacks or repairs. One frequent error includes insufficient consideration of opening dimensions, resulting in frames that are either too small (requiring excessive filling) or too big (necessitating challenging trimming).

Inappropriate anchoring represents another substantial concern. Frames repaired just to drywall or inadequate plug repairings will eventually loosen under regular usage, especially for frequently used entrance doors. The repairing pattern should engage structural aspects of the wall, with adequately robust fixings at regular periods throughout the frame boundary.

Disregarding proper drainage and ventilation can result in long-lasting issues. While UPVC itself withstands moisture damage, inadequate ventilation within cavity closers or in between frame layers can promote condensation problems. Likewise, threshold information must allow for water drainage to prevent accumulation that might jeopardize seals or surrounding products.

Keeping Your UPVC Door Frame


Once installed, UPVC door frames need minimal continuous maintenance to preserve their look and performance. Regular cleaning with a moderate detergent option eliminates accumulated dirt and avoids the progressive loss of surface area finish that can take place in urban or commercial environments. Avoid abrasive cleaners or tools that could scratch the frame surface area.

Periodic evaluation of weather seals and moving parts guarantees ongoing efficiency. seals that show indications of breaking, solidifying, or separation should be replaced promptly to maintain weatherproofing and energy efficiency. Hinges and locking mechanisms gain from yearly lubrication utilizing proper penetrating oils to prevent tightness and wear.

Frequently Asked Questions About UPVC Door Frame Installation


The length of time does a normal UPVC door frame setup take?

An expert installation generally needs between four and six hours for a basic door opening, presuming no problems emerge from the existing structure or opening conditions. Do it yourself setups might require additional time, particularly for those with limited experience in door fitting. Complex circumstances involving structural modifications or non-standard opening sizes naturally extend the timeline.

Can UPVC door frames be installed in any kind of wall building?

UPVC door frames appropriate for most standard wall buildings, including brick, block, timber frame, and steel frame systems. However, the fixing method and suitable anchors differ according to the substrate. Cavity wall constructions require unique considerations relating to cavity trays and wetness barriers. Consulting with a professional or the frame manufacturer helps identify any particular requirements for non-standard wall types.

Do UPVC door frames require special licenses or structure regulation approval?

Building regulations use to door setups where substantial structural modifications take place, such as widening an existing opening or installing a new door where none existed formerly. Simply changing an existing door frame in an existing opening generally falls under allowed advancement in a lot of jurisdictions. However, regulations regarding fire safety, accessibility, and energy effectiveness might use in particular circumstances. Contacting regional authorities offers clarity on any requirements.

What should I do if my UPVC door frame ends up being harmed?

Small surface damage such as scratches can often be resolved utilizing specialized UPVC repair sets or fillers developed for this function. More substantial damage, consisting of structural cracks or warping, generally needs element replacement. Lots of manufacturers use spare parts for their item varieties, though accessibility may be limited for older setups. Sometimes, complete frame replacement proves more affordable than comprehensive repairs.

How do I understand if my existing door opening is appropriate for a UPVC frame?

An appropriate opening should be structurally sound, without any considerable degeneration in the surrounding wall structure. The measurements must permit for proper clearances around the frame— typically 10-15mm on each side and the top, with the bottom determined by threshold requirements. The opening needs to be fairly square, though small irregularities can be accommodated through adjustable repairing systems and careful packaging throughout setup.
